An Energy Performance Certificate tells you how efficient the property is in terms of heating and insulation. All of our properties have one and the details will be provided to you prior to signing the Tenancy.

Our properties are fully furnished, but we do NOT provide items such as kitchen utensils and bedding, therefore you will need to bring these with you when you move in.
To ensure that both health and safety regulations are maintained at all times, we recommend that tenants do not bring their own furniture or electrical goods into the property. If you do have items you wish to bring please advise us first and note that all furniture or furnishings brought into the property must comply with the Furniture and Furnishings Safety Regulations and electrical goods should have been PAT tested (Portable Appliance testing). You are responsible for removal of any personal items at the end of the tenancy.
